Royal Oak House sits in a quiet residential neighborhood where folks can feel at home, and the place has a simple single-story layout that makes it easy to get around, with a mix of private suites, shared rooms, and studio apartments that come already furnished, so there's no heavy lifting needed and you get a private bath and sometimes even a kitchenette, plus there's air-conditioning to keep comfortable and the rooms have phone service, cable TV, and internet if you like to keep in touch or watch a show, and you can even bring a pet as long as everyone gets along. They serve three meals a day, which are made by chefs and meal planners who try to pick good ingredients, and the staff keep the place clean and are available round the clock, with on-site nursing supervision and a team trained to give medication, help with personal care, or just answer when someone calls for help, so there's always someone to lend a hand, even at night. Folks who live here don't have to worry about maintenance, cleaning, or cooking, because the housekeeping and upkeep are all handled, and there are also beauty services and things like cable and Wi-Fi included, making life a bit easier, especially for those wanting more independence but needing support. For people dealing with memory issues like Alzheimer's or dementia, there's a special Memory Care area with programs and therapies aimed at their needs, so they get both safety and proper care, and families can choose just the right level of care whether it's independent or assisted living, full nursing care, or even hospice and respite care if that's needed for a short stay. Recreation is important here, so every day there are morning and afternoon activities, exercise sessions, health programs, and something called life enrichment programs to keep folks social and active, and staff always look to make the place feel welcoming and respectful, with a real family-like feeling. The building's designed for safety, handicap accessible, and there's a system for scoring how the community's doing, plus a Director of Marketing who meets with families and helps them with move-in advice or scheduling tours, even if someone can only visit after hours or on a weekend, because they know moving can be a lot and try to help however they can. Royal Oak House's main goal is to support wellness, memory care, and independence, while keeping everything homelike and steady, so residents can live as well as possible in a place that takes care of their daily needs.

Yes, Royal Oak House offers respite care. Respite care in assisted living communities provides temporary, short-term relief for primary caregivers by offering professional care for their loved ones. It allows individuals to stay in an assisted living community for a limited time, giving caregivers a break while ensuring residents receive necessary support and assistance with daily activities.
